FAQs: Ita Bag Meaning, Anime Pin Bags & Styles

What exactly is an ita bag?

An ita bag is a bag, often clear-fronted, customized with anime, manga, or gaming merchandise. The "ita" in ita bag meaning "painful" or "ouch" in Japanese, refers to the sheer amount of pins, keychains, and other items displayed, and potentially the pain your wallet feels after buying all the merch!

What kind of things can you put inside an ita bag?

You can personalize your ita bag with almost anything related to your favorite characters or series. Common items include enamel pins, buttons, keychains, plushies, trading cards, and straps. It’s all about showing off your fandom and expressing your personality.

Are ita bags only for anime and manga fans?

While often associated with anime and manga, ita bags aren’t exclusive to those fandoms. Anyone can create an ita bag based on their interests. You might see ita bags dedicated to video games, bands, TV shows, or even original characters. The core ita bag meaning applies across all interests.

What are some common styles of ita bags?

Ita bags come in various styles, including backpacks, tote bags, messenger bags, and even wallets. Some have fully clear fronts, while others feature viewing windows or internal display boards. The best style for you depends on your personal preferences and how much you want to display.
